Sudha Sreenivasan is among the prominent vocalists in the galaxy of Carnatic music today. She took her initial lessons under her mother Janani Sarala and is among the fortunate ones who had the opportunity of getting trained in one of the best Music schools in the globe. It is none other than the well-acclaimed Kalakshetra. After obtaining her diploma from that esteemed school, she started to cruise in musical waters. From then onwards there was no looking back in her career.

Her unquenchable thirst for Carnatic music drove her to take advanced lessons from eminent gurus like Mani Krishnaswamy, T M Tyagarajan, T K Subramanyan and so on. Her training under the Sangeeta Pitamaha, Semmangudi R Srinivasa Iyer, prepared her for a melodious and relaxed way of singing and handling complex compositions with ease. 

A singer bestowed with an excellent shrill voice, she won appreciation wherever she sang. Right from her childhood she has been her audience's favourite. To list a few, she won the 'Best child voice' Award in 1983 and was recognised as the Best Vocalist in the year 1987. Not only that, Sudha Sreenivasan has won laurels throughout her musical career.
